A melting pot in Nou Barris where creativity gives shape to shared stories, redefining the space by giving it a new urban meaning.Shozy's Clock Tower pays tribute to one of Trinitat Nova's most iconic symbols. Built in 1953 to mark the rhythm of life in the neighborhood, the tower became a symbol of identity until its demolition in 2013, leaving a deep emotional mark on the residents. The work recreates this presence through a poetic and conceptual reinterpretation: empty quadrants, tunnels, and stones symbolize memories and the passage of time, transforming destruction into a gesture of remembrance.
